Comyn Kelleher Tobin is a progressive and growing law firm with a professional staff of 17 Solicitors along with support staff consisting of Legal Executives, Trainee Solicitors, Accountancy and Bookkeeping Staff and Secretarial Staff.
Comyn Kelleher Tobin was founded in 1982 and has expanded considerably and developed extensive skill and expertise over the past 25 years. Its development has been founded on a high level of interaction with its Client base and a pro-active response to the needs of the Clientele. Over the years mergers with other Cork based firms such as Hughes & MacEvilly and Arthur Comyn & Co. have continued the growth of the firm and have provided additional expertise in other areas of law.

Internally, its development is based upon the development of team work involving units committed to particular areas of expertise such as Property Law, Commercial Law and Litigation. We also have a dedicated Health Care Law Department. The operations of the firm are overseen by its Managing Partner Debbie Moore.
